The recent introduction of the Multiverse into the Marvel Cinematic Universe and the rumors of past Spider-Man actors teaming up with Tom Holland has given rise to rampant fan speculation that other actors from earlier Marvel films could be making their MCU debuts through the use of the Multiverse, with Hugh Jackman's Wolverine naturally high on most fans' lists for a character people would like to see show up in the MCU. Jackman, however, appears to have thoroughly dispelled the rumor in a new interview.

Jackman appeared on Jake Hamilton's interview show, Jake's Takes, to discuss his new film, Reminiscence, and Hamilton has obviously heard the same speculation as everyone else over the Multiverse, but when he put it to Jackman, he got an answer that will disappoint a whole lot of fans.

First off, Jackman responded to Hamilton's specific reference to the Multiverse giving older actors a chance to reprise their roles with, "That fact that I’m hearing about this from you, and there’s nothing in my inbox from Kevin Feige means it’s probably, no matter what idea I came up with, not on the table."

However, Jackman then further elaborated, "Let’s just be clear. I realized, before we shot Logan, I was like, we got the idea. We knew what it was going to be-ish, right? And I thought this is it. And that really helped me, it really helped knowing I was going into my last season, that it was my last season that I made the most of it. And it’s still a character I hold close to my heart. But I know it’s done."

Jackman then joked, "Tell that to whoever you want. Please tell it to Ryan [Reynolds]. Because he’s like, doesn’t believe anything, he thinks I’m joking, please."

Just a month ago, fans were reading into Jackman sharing a BossLogic Wolverine drawing followed by a photo of Jackman with Kevin Feige a day later, but if Jackman is telling the truth here, those social media posts were just coincidences.

Still, in the modern era of super secrecy with regards to film spoilers, there is always the very real possibility that any denial is just a feint, and only time will tell if Jackman is seriously done with Wolverine or not.
